How to use:
Print out, cut up. It can be played in small or large groups. Hand out all of
the cards to pupils, each has roughly the same number of cards. The student
with the 1st card starts by asking Who has...? The pupil with the matching
card replies and asks Who has...? The game finishes when pupils get to the
last card.
During the activity teacher monitors the correct use of articles.
2. Memory Game
Print out and cut up. It can be played in small groups. For bigger classes
print out several times and play in a number of groups. Students look for pairs.

Directions for the Card Game:
1. Students are put into small groups with an even number of players.
2. Each group is split into 2 teams.
3. The clue giver will start a 1 minute timer and turn over a card so nobody can see. (colors don' matter)
4. The clue giver now says words (not sounds or gestures) to get their team to guess the word at the top of the card.
5. The clue giver cannot say any of the words (or forms of the words) listed on the card. Formations include: abbreviations, tenses (past, present, future), initials, spelling, letters, sounds like, rhyming, smaller version words, compound words.
6. Teammates can guess as many words as possible before the timer runs out.
7. The clue giver may pass on a word and place it in a discard pile.
8. If the clue giver uses an illegal word, the opposing team who is monitoring, can sound a buzzer or shout the word "AVID." Then the clue giver must place the card in the discard pile and try a new word.
9. When the timer is done the team will count up how many points earned based off of how many words were guessed correctly. The opposing team gets one point for each card placed in the discard pile.
10 Switch teams and repeat. The team with the highest points, wins!

How to play
This card game is an excellent way to practice and memorize the verb TO BE and the I AM + ADJECTIVE construction. It will have your students speaking to each other in English the whole time! They will make affirmative and negative statements about what they can and can't do.
One player distributes five cards to each player (2 to 4 per group). The rest of the cards are placed in a stack in the middle. One player begins the game by asking another player to give him a card. He or she might say, "Do you have I AM HUNGRY?"
The goal is to come up with 7 complete families. The different verbs represent the families. There are 6 cards to a family (I - YOU - HE - SHE - WE - THEY). Students will find it helpful to group together the cards that have the same picture at the top (flower, flip-flops, etc.) If the player doesn't have it, he says "Go fish". If he draws the card that he asked for, he can continue to play and ask someone for another card. Each time a player comes up with all six members of a family, he can make a stack. At the end of the game, the player with the most sets of families wins!
